Minister of Economy: Free Industrial Zone to be Built near Anaklia Sea Port

The Minister of Economy and Sustainable Development, Dimitri Kumsishvili announced the opening of a free industrial zone in the vicinity of Anaklia Sea Port.

“The Free industrial zone will be set up behind the Anaklia port, on 600 hectares of land, that will also create additional workplaces,” the Minister stated.

“Georgia will carry out many projects thanks to the forum,” Kumsisvili added, “a very significant project will be signed and implemented in the town of Tkbuli.”

“We have also discussed the transit potential and the possibilities the transit will have. Anaklia port will represent billions in investments. A free industrial zone will also be arranged behind the port which will lead to the creation of additional workspace,” the Minister Stated at the Silk Road Forum, on the biggest Georgian governmental activities of 2015 which is currently underway.
